The user experience (UX) of fitness trackers is crucial for enabling users to interpret data, foster understanding, and ultimately drive long-term motivation and self-efficacy in health improvement. This user-centred design research insight is drawn from a 2017 study published in Informatics. Using Situated diary study and questionnaire assessment with 34 participants, researchers explored how this design variable affects real-world outcomes. The key design takeaway: Focus on designing intuitive interfaces and feedback mechanisms that translate raw data into meaningful, motivating insights for users, thereby enhancing their self-efficacy in health management.

Method & Evidence
Variables
Strengths & Limitations
Strengths
- +Utilized a situated diary study, providing real-world usage context.
- +Combined qualitative (diary) and quantitative (questionnaire) data for a more comprehensive understanding.
Limitations
The study involved a relatively small sample size and focused on specific devices, so results might not apply universally to all fitness trackers or user demographics.
Reliability & validity
Reliability could be enhanced by using standardized diary prompts and a validated questionnaire (HTSE). Validity is supported by the situated nature of the study, reflecting real-world use, and triangulation of data from diaries and questionnaires.

Design Principles
"The effectiveness of health-focused wearables is contingent upon a user experience that actively cultivates understanding, motivation, and self-efficacy."
For designers of health-focused wearables and mobile applications, a well-crafted UX is not merely about aesthetics or ease of use; it's a fundamental driver of user engagement and sustained behavioral change. Neglecting UX can lead to devices being abandoned, undermining their potential health benefits.
